Just clarifying the other comments/solution in that it looks like the problem is available space on the server.
The trace shows that this is happening as it is trying to Serialize some class, and so the .NET framework, using Reflection and Code Generation, is trying to create/compile the serialization assembly.
So look at where the server application is serializing classes.
